Common Dryer Issues
Dryer Won’t Start : This could be due to a tripped circuit breaker, a faulty door switch, or issues with the thermal fuse.
No Heat or Insufficient Heat : Often caused by a malfunctioning heating element, a blown thermal fuse, or issues with the thermostat.
Dryer Takes Too Long to Dry Clothes : Check for a clogged lint filter, obstructed venting, or a defective thermostat.
Dryer Makes Unusual Noises : This could be due to worn-out drum bearings, a damaged belt, or foreign objects caught in the drum.
Dryer Shuts Off Mid-Cycle : Possible causes include overheating, faulty thermostats, or problems with the motor.
